Learn what "let me finish my drawing now" means, when people say it, and how to use it naturally in English.

This means the speaker wants uninterrupted time to complete their activity.
From Mafia Lord'S Son Has Secret Love For His Stepmom, Episode 25
The speaker is asking for a moment to finish drawing before being interrupted.
Use this when you need space to finish a task. It is polite enough for everyday conversation.
